The Falklands
The Falkland Islands is a group of over 100 islands in the southern Atlantic off the coast of Argentina. The islands are a British Overseas Territory and have been a source of dispute between Argentina and the United Kingdom. The capital of the Falkland Islands is Stanley.

The islands (claimed by Argentina) are the Falkland Islands (Islas Malvinas), site of a 1982 war between the UK and Argentina.Other islands in the area are the frigid South Georgia Islands and the South Sandwich Islands, also under the administration of the United Kingdom.
